This is a reduced version of Jan Jansson's map of France. The map extends to a portion of Italy and Switzerland and is filled with detail of the topography, cities, and towns. It is graced with an elaborate cartouche flanked by a pair of armed and armored warriors, topped with lilies representing France. The royal crest is shown at the upper right and ships and galleys sail the seas.
